Single dads
If you’re a single dad, it can be difficult sometimes to find the information that’s relevant to you. You may feel like other single parents view you differently or that you’re left out of the support that’s given to them. All this can make the job of bringing up your children on your own feel very isolating.
However, you are absolutely not alone. Eight per cent of Britain’s 2 million single parents are dads, meaning lots of other single parents have the same concerns as you.
At Gingerbread, we think single dads do a brilliant job of caring for their families, often under very difficult circumstances.
